A tragic accident took place in Jaipur, Rajasthan, where a truck carrying chemical collide with several other vehicle and caught fire on Friday morning. Seven individual as well as 37 other injured in this accident.
According to reports, the accident took place in front of a petrol pump on the Jaipur-Ajmer highway in the area of Bhankrota, Jaipur in the morning. After the collision of the truck dozens of vehicle caught fire. Videos that taken from distance can seen the accident site which was thick of smokes from the vehicles that caught fire.
Some people sustained burns injuries in the accident.
Station House Officer (SHO), Bhankrota, Manish Gupta said, โThe fire engulfed several trucks. The number of trucks involved in the incident is not clear. Some people with burn injuries have rushed to hospitals in ambulances.โ
A 300-meter stretch of the highway affected by the accident, causing traffic to come to a standstill and creating a long line of vehicles. Meanwhile, a special traffic route set up to take the injured to SMS Hospital.
Emergency Services reached to the accident area
Emergency service, Fire brigades are at the spot and are trying to bring the blaze under uncontrol.
Jaipur District Magistrate Jitendra Soni stated that at around 40 vehicle catches fire in the incident.
More than 25 ambulances are at the spot and sifted injured people to the hospital.
An eyewitness stated through ANI, โI and my friend were travelling from Rajsamand to Jaipur…Our bus suddenly stopped around 5.30 in the morning and we heard a massive blast. There was fire everywhere around the bus…The door of the bus was locked so we broke the window and jumped out of the bus. Along with us, around 7-8 more people jumped from the window. There were continuous blasts one after the other. There was a petrol pump nearby…โ
